Innovator U.S. Equity Buffer ETF - August (BAUG)
BAUG is a passive ETF by Innovator tracking the investment results of the Cboe S&P 500 Buffer Protect Index August. BAUG launched on Aug 1, 2019 and has a 0.79% expense ratio.

BAUGWorst Drawdowns
The table below shows the maximum drawdowns of the Innovator U.S. Equity Buffer ETF - August. A maximum drawdown is an indicator of risk. It shows a reduction in portfolio value from its maximum due to a series of losing trades.
The maximum drawdown since January 2010 for the Innovator U.S. Equity Buffer ETF - August is 24.19%, recorded on Mar 23, 2020. It took 84 trading sessions for the portfolio to recover.
